This is a drawing of a historical scene at a fortress. The drawing features a monochrome image depicting figures and horses in motion around an imposing fortress with towers and battlements. Flags fly atop one of the towers, and the sense of motion and activity is evident from the dynamic posture of the horses and figures. The architecture suggests medieval or early Renaissance style, evoking a scene of a siege or a significant event. The artwork is highly detailed despite its small size and uses a single color palette for a dramatic effect.
